Abbyland Trucking's Truck, Trailer, & RV Washbay Process
At Abbyland Trucking, we use a clear and professional process. This helps us make sure every wash meets industry standards. We aim to deliver consistent, high-quality results.
Pre-Wash Inspection & Clearing
We begin by removing any debris, bedding, manure, or waste. For livestock trailers, this involves scraping out bedding and manure before any water is used.
Soak & Apply Detergent
Next, we use soaps or detergents to break down tough residues like road salt, mud, or animal waste. Soaps are essential in washouts to reduce cleaning time and improve results.
High-Pressure Wash With Hot Water
Using hot-water pressure washers helps dissolve grime faster and more thoroughly. It also speeds up drying time, which is crucial before disinfection.
Full Interior & Exterior Cleaning
For trailers, especially livestock or cargo trailers, we clean every surface. This includes the ceiling, walls, floors, undercarriage, wheels, gates, ramps, and storage boxes.
Rinse & Drain
After washing, we rinse thoroughly and drain the trailers on a slight slope to ensure all dirty water flows out properly.
Drying & final inspection
We allow the trailer to dry completely — moisture left behind can reduce disinfectant effectiveness. After drying, we inspect to ensure a clean, ready-to-use trailer.

In-Depth Techniques Used by Abbyland Trucking
We employ industry-best practices and techniques to ensure thorough, safe, and effective cleaning:
- High-pressure hot water cleaning: We use hot water pressure washers at 140–176 °F (60–80 °C). This helps dissolve tough manure, organic material, road grime, and salt buildup.
- Top-to-bottom & front-to-back cleaning order: We clean from top to bottom and front to back. For interior washouts, we wash ceilings, walls, and floors in a set order. This helps avoid spreading dirt around.
- Detergent use before rinsing: Soaps break down fats, organic matter, and mineral deposits. This greatly reduces wash time compared to using only water.
- Proper wastewater handling & disposal: We operate in compliance with environmental standards for vehicle washing, ensuring wash water is properly contained, treated, and disposed of rather than letting it run into storm drains or untreated systems
- Disinfection and biosecurity protocols (for livestock trailers): After cleaning and drying, trailers are disinfected using compatible products to reduce pathogen risk. Organic matter is removed first, and disinfectants are applied only to clean surfaces for maximum effectiveness.
These techniques help us provide a clean trailer. It also meets hygiene, safety, and regulatory standards. This is especially important for livestock and food-grade hauling operations.
Environmental and Health Considerations
Clean trailers aren't just about aesthetics — they have real environmental and health implications.
- Preventing disease spread in livestock transport: Trailers that carry animals can harbor manure, pathogens, and biofilms, which can spread disease to new herds or farms. Thorough cleaning and disinfection before each trip helps reduce the risk.
- Avoiding contamination of water systems: Wash water, especially from undercarriage cleaning or chemical degreaser use, must be properly collected and treated. Letting wastewater flow uncontrolled into storm drains or groundwater risks pollution and regulatory violations.
- Using environmentally friendly cleaning products: Modern wash services (including professional facilities) increasingly use biodegradable, phosphate-free detergents that break down more easily in wastewater treatment.
- Worker and driver safety: High-pressure washers and chemical disinfectants pose risks if improperly used. Professional washbays like Abbyland Trucking follow protocols to minimize hazards.
Choosing a professional washbay helps ensure your trailer is clean and that washout practices are environmentally responsible and safe for everyone involved.
